Develop a Comprehensive Cleansing Checklist



Developing a detailed cleansing checklist can make your Airbnb turnover procedure smoother and much more effective. Beginning by listing all locations in your space, including rooms, bathrooms, cooking area, and living areas.


Do not neglect the information-- check for dirt on surfaces, tidy mirrors, and vacuum carpetings. Consist of laundry tasks like transforming bed linens and towels, as fresh bed linens can leave a long lasting impression.


By following this list, you'll enhance your cleaning process, decrease stress and anxiety, and assure your visitors arrive to a clean setting. Plus, a clean home boosts guest satisfaction and encourages favorable reviews, which is vital for your Airbnb success.

Make Use Of the Right Cleaning Products



After dealing with the high-traffic areas, it's time to show on the cleaning products you utilize. Choosing the right cleansing supplies can make all the distinction in attaining a spick-and-span space that wows your visitors.


Do not fail to remember about anti-bacterials-- especially in kitchen areas and washrooms. Make sure they're EPA-approved for optimum efficiency versus bacteria. Microfiber towels are vital for dusting and cleaning down surfaces considering that they capture dirt without scraping.


For floorings, discover a cleaner suitable for your flooring type, whether it's wood, laminate, or floor tile. Ultimately, consider adding a pleasurable fragrance with air fresheners or important oils, as a fresh-smelling space enhances the total experience. Your choice of items can truly elevate your Airbnb's tidiness and setting.

Preserve a Consistent Cleansing Set Up



Preserving a regular cleansing schedule is important for keeping your Airbnb in top form and ensuring guest complete satisfaction. By setting a regular cleaning routine, you create a reliable home clean home setting for your guests, which aids develop trust and motivates favorable reviews. Begin by figuring out a cleansing regularity that suits your residential or commercial property and visitor turnover.


After each guest's stay, assign time for thorough cleaning, including cleaning, vacuuming, and sterilizing high-touch locations. Do not fail to remember to examine towels and linens, guaranteeing they're fresh and clean for the next arrival.


In addition to post-checkout cleansing, consider organizing once a week maintenance tasks, such as deep medical office cleaning cleaning carpetings or windows. This will certainly prevent dust buildup and keep your home looking excellent.


Finally, adhere to your schedule as carefully as feasible. Uniformity not just improves your visitors' experience yet also reflects your commitment to high quality hospitality.

How Can I Manage Cleaning After a Family Pet Remain?



After a pet dog remain, vacuum cleaner thoroughly to get rid of hair, usage enzyme cleaners for spots, and clean all bed linens. Do not fail to remember to air out the room and look for any remaining smells to guarantee freshness.
